Pink Amethyst Properties

Color: Pink
Mohs Hardness: 7
Chakra: Heart
Crystal Structure:Trigonal
Location: Brazil, Argentina, Uruguay

The history of Pink Amethyst

The history of Pink Amethyst is not as well-documented as some other gemstones. However, amethyst itself has a rich history that dates back centuries. Amethyst was highly valued in ancient civilizations and was often associated with royalty and spirituality. It had protective and healing properties and was used in various forms of jewelry and adornments. The discovery of Pink Amethyst as a distinct variety of amethyst is relatively recent, and it has gained popularity among crystal enthusiasts and collectors for its unique color and energetic properties. While its specific history may be less known, Pink Amethyst continues to captivate individuals with its beauty and metaphysical qualities.

How to clean Pink Amethyst?

To clean Pink Amethyst, you can gently wipe it with a soft cloth or use a mild soap and lukewarm water.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ials that may damage the gemstone. It is also recommended to avoid exposing Pink Amethyst to excessive heat or direct sunlight, as it may cause the color to fade.

Where is Pink Amethyst found?

Pink Amethyst is primarily found in Brazil, specifically in the state of Rio Grande do Sul. It is also found in other parts of the world, including Uruguay and Argentina. The gemstone is typically mined from geodes or cavities within volcanic rocks.

What is the hardness of Pink Amethyst?

Pink Amethyst has a hardness of 7 on the Mohs scale, which means it is relatively durable and resistant to scratches. However, it is still important to handle it with care and avoid exposing it to harsh chemicals or abrasive materials that may damage its surface.
